An Executive Certificate in Arts Venue Sales and Promotion equips professionals with the essential skills to thrive in the dynamic arts and entertainment industry. This intensive program focuses on practical application, enabling graduates to immediately improve their sales strategies and promotional campaigns.
Learning outcomes include mastering advanced sales techniques specific to arts venues, developing targeted marketing plans leveraging digital strategies and traditional media, and building strong relationships with clients and stakeholders. The curriculum also covers crucial aspects of budgeting, sponsorship acquisition, and box office management.
The program's duration is typically designed to be flexible, accommodating working professionals. Options might include part-time or intensive formats, allowing participants to complete the certificate at a pace that suits their schedules. Inquire about specific program lengths offered by different institutions.
This certificate program holds significant industry relevance, preparing graduates for roles such as Sales Manager, Marketing Director, or even Venue Director within theaters, concert halls, museums, and other arts organizations.
